Failure Date: 03/07/2014

A friend was driving my truck in a residential neighborhood. He was only going 20 mph when the gas light came on but the needle said it had half a tank. All of a sudden the radio locked up and all the needles on the dash started going crazy all the emblems on the dash lite up. We parked and turned off the truck. As soon as we went to turn back we had just started it not even 3 minutes later all of the gauges and lights on the truck it started freaking out again and now the driver side mirror and window control would no longer work. Earlier that day I had taken it in a reputable shop to get the truck smogged and get it checked out. The truck passed smog and they said the truck had no problems. This was the first time it had ever done anything like this.
